Ugandan Killed In Cold Blood In South Africa

By Our Correspondent

SOUTH AFRICA

POLICE in South Africa is hunting for a Somali extremist who allegedly shot dead a Ugandan killing him instantly.

Henry Ssentongo who lived in Kawempe Mbogo, in Kawempe division before relocating to South Africa was shot dead last Tuesday.

The incident happened in Gauteng’s township of Ranga-lakita when the Somali killed Ssentongo over a disagreement about furniture.

The Somali had contracted Ssentongo to make him a sofar set but they got a misunderstanding and he killed him and took off.

According to Mr Maple Julio a journalist based in South Africa , the Somali who was in the company of his wife came to pick his sofar but got it unready starting a heated exchange.

The Somali allegedly ran back home and came back with a gun and shot Ssentongo dead.

By press time the Ssentongo’s body was still in the hands of Gauteng police authority.

But Sheikh Ali Ssekamatte one of leaders of Uganda community in South Africa said they were mobilizing resources to return the remains to Uganda.

He cautioned Ugandans living in South Africa to be extra cautious saying the environment is not so conducive saying many of his members have met death in unclear circumstances.
